The Udupi Superintendent of Police (SP), Hariram Shankar, on Thursday suspended a Deputy Superintendent of Police, a Police Inspector, and another policeman attached to the Karkala police station after a Kannada news channel aired a sting operation showing the three personnel reportedly accepting a gift.Deputy Superintendent of Police Vijay Prasad, Police Inspector Sandeep and office staffer Shivanand were suspended on Thursday pending a disciplinary inquiry. In a statement, Mr. Shankar said the order was based on a preliminary inquiry by the Additional Superintendent of Police, Udupi.In the video telecast by the news channel, Sandeep is seen accepting a gift offered by an official who claimed to be a representative of an agency executing work related to the Varahi Irrigation Project. Shivanand is seen accepting the gift from the agency official on the instructions of Prasad. Published - July 30, 2026 09:31 pm IST
